Havells Signs Agreement to Procure Renewable Power from Kundan Solar’s 15 MW Project – EQ
In Short : Havells has entered into a power procurement agreement with Kundan Solar to source electricity from its 15 MW solar project. This move allows Havells to cut carbon emissions, lower energy costs, and advance its sustainability commitments. The partnership highlights the increasing trend of Indian corporates adopting renewable power to strengthen ESG goals and minimize reliance on grid electricity.
In Detail : Havells has announced an agreement to procure green power from Kundan Solar’s 15 MW solar facility. This strategic move reflects the company’s growing commitment to reducing environmental impact and enhancing its sustainability profile through renewable energy adoption.
The agreement will enable Havells to secure a portion of its energy requirements through solar power, reducing dependence on conventional grid electricity. This shift supports cost stabilization and long-term operational efficiency.
Kundan Solar’s 15 MW project is designed to generate clean energy that can be supplied to corporate buyers under open access arrangements. Havells will benefit from a reliable source of renewable electricity tailored to industrial consumption patterns.
